It definitely required more views on my part to fully appreciate it. On my first viewing I thought it was a bit of a disappointment as a horror movie, because that's what i thought it was. But it stuck to me, I would fall asleep thinking about it and wake up with it still in my head. Second time around I had to not think of it as a horror movie and more of a fantasy/drama/suspense combination and I really liked it. I understood more of it and the deeper meaning of its themes. Showed it to a few of my friends and they all liked it. I think a lot of people expected jump scares given the current and recent trends in horror movies, specifically the witches genre.

>>69048824
Ignore those anons. Back when they used wood block letters (upper case [held in the case above your head] and lower case [in the case near the floor]) sometimes, to save money on buying them, or if they are lost certain letters could be used to make up other letters. Specifically the V to make M and W.

The director explained this somewhere, though I'm not sure that's the only reason for the VV. Regardless of the reasoning, it's a brilliantly simple and enigmatic look for the title of the film.
